West Ham in advanced talks to sign relegated winger

Published:

Moyes has been eyeing possible candidates to help Michail Antonio in his front yard just about all summer, his sights now set on an excellent relegated winger.

Ivory Coast International, Maxwel Cornet, who is needed by various other EPL clubs, including but not limited to Newcastle and Everton, is the person in query.

The player netted nine impressive goals from 26 appearances for Burnley last season, which in itself is an almost unprecedented feat considering his team was in a relegation battle a lot of the season.

After several reports and confirmation linking the 25-year-old to West Ham, Sky Sports now reports that the Hammers are within the latter stages of their negotiations with Burnley for the versatile winger.

The discharge clause (17.5M kilos) for Cornet isn’t a small sum, but for West Ham, it’s almost nothing in the event that they’ll get someone of Cornet’s calibre on their side in return.

His prowess on the front, in midfield, and even defense is not going to just give Moyes Antonio’s help but something higher, and that is strictly what the Hammers must successfully fend off competition in domestic and European competitions.

It’s almost improbable that Maxwell (considering his top class and form) will likely be satisfied staying with a second-tier side, so the London side has a likelihood to tug him in.

Furthermore, the allure of playing in a European Cup might just be too great for other competitors to match, so Moyes’s side might be said to have one hand on the winger already.
